Wotherspoon appears to play with very little confidence, which stops him from reaching the standard he is capable of on a consistent basis. He got a lift when he signed for Saints and was pretty good in the opening months of his time with us but when he has a few bad games, the head seems to drop more than most players. Hibs responded to that by dropping him, Tommy Wright tried to manage it by letting him play through it but that hasn't really worked either. The key could be simply making him believe in himself a bit more, as when he does, he can have a great end product as an attacking midfielder. His part in Stevie May's goal at Firhill last season was brilliant.

This is 100% correct. Its a minor thing and probably doesn't have much bearing on anything, but it frustrates the life out of me how apologetic he is once he's made a mistake. It could be just a bad pass or taking a shot when he should of passed but he instantly apologises to everyone and seems to start beating himself up, it might be better if he started telling them to f**k off, or do anything other than blame himself really.

In saying all of that Chris Millar can miscontrol a simple ball and then explode in rage at anyone who dared be in his eyeline and it doesn't really help him control the next one all that much more.
